Přejít na obsah
Menu
You need to be registered to interact with the community.
This question has been flagged
5216 Zobrazení
from odoo import models, fields, api, _
class ResUsers(models.Model):
     _inherit = "res.users"
    @api.multi
    def action_button_test(self):
      partner_rec = self.env['res.partner'].search([],limit=1)
      employee_rec = self.env['hr.employee'].search([],limit=1)
      phone = partner_rec.phone
      mobile = employee_rec.work_phone
      if phone == mobile:
      users = self.env['res.users'].search([('active', '=', False)])
      for user in users:
      user.write({'active': True})
      else:
      admins = self.env['res.users'].search([('login', '!=', 'admin')])
      for admin in admins:
      admin.write({'active': False})

My objective is to update value if phone and mobile number match.

Please show me how to make it work.

Thank you.  

Avatar
Zrušit
Autor

Can someone look into the code to make it work.

Related Posts Odpovědi Zobrazení Aktivita
1
bře 23
2344
3
srp 19
12744
7
čvc 19
4733
0
čvn 19
3102
2
zář 18
3171